Britain has lost the Falklands War, Margaret Thatcher battles Tony Benn for power, and Alan Turing achieves a breakthrough in artificial intelligence. Language eng Summary "Machines Like Me occurs in an alternative 1980s London. London (England) - History - 20th century - Fiction.Label Machines like me : and people like you Title Machines like me Title remainder and people like you Statement of responsibility Ian McEwan Creator Ian McEwan's subversive and entertaining new novel poses fundamental questions: What makes us human? Our outward deeds or our inner lives? Could a machine understand the human heart? This provocative and thrilling tale warns against the power to invent things beyond our control".
